|
@ -69,6 +69,17 @@ |
|
|
</el-option> |
|
|
</el-option> |
|
|
</el-select> |
|
|
</el-select> |
|
|
</el-form-item> |
|
|
</el-form-item> |
|
|
|
|
|
<el-form-item label="接种点" |
|
|
|
|
|
prop="siteId"> |
|
|
|
|
|
<el-select v-model="dataForm.siteId" clearable |
|
|
|
|
|
placeholder="请选择"> |
|
|
|
|
|
<el-option v-for="item in siteOptions" |
|
|
|
|
|
:key="item.value" |
|
|
|
|
|
:label="item.label" |
|
|
|
|
|
:value="item.value"> |
|
|
|
|
|
</el-option> |
|
|
|
|
|
</el-select> |
|
|
|
|
|
</el-form-item> |
|
|
<el-form-item label="已接种至第" |
|
|
<el-form-item label="已接种至第" |
|
|
prop="vaccNo" v-if="dataForm.dose === 0"> |
|
|
prop="vaccNo" v-if="dataForm.dose === 0"> |
|
|
<el-input-number v-model="dataForm.vaccNo" |
|
|
<el-input-number v-model="dataForm.vaccNo" |
|
@ -88,6 +99,10 @@ |
|
|
<el-form-item> |
|
|
<el-form-item> |
|
|
<el-button type="primary" @click="beforeGetDataList()">{{ $t('query') }}</el-button> |
|
|
<el-button type="primary" @click="beforeGetDataList()">{{ $t('query') }}</el-button> |
|
|
</el-form-item> |
|
|
</el-form-item> |
|
|
|
|
|
<el-form-item> |
|
|
|
|
|
<el-button type="primary" |
|
|
|
|
|
@click="exportHandle()">{{ $t('export') }}</el-button> |
|
|
|
|
|
</el-form-item> |
|
|
<el-form-item> |
|
|
<el-form-item> |
|
|
<el-button v-if="$hasPermission('demo:reportuserinfo:updateAge')" |
|
|
<el-button v-if="$hasPermission('demo:reportuserinfo:updateAge')" |
|
|
type="danger" |
|
|
type="danger" |
|
@ -224,7 +239,8 @@ export default { |
|
|
getDataListURL: '/sys/vaccinationinfo/page', |
|
|
getDataListURL: '/sys/vaccinationinfo/page', |
|
|
getDataListIsPage: true, |
|
|
getDataListIsPage: true, |
|
|
deleteURL: '/sys/vaccinationinfo', |
|
|
deleteURL: '/sys/vaccinationinfo', |
|
|
deleteIsBatch: true |
|
|
deleteIsBatch: true, |
|
|
|
|
|
exportURL: '/sys/vaccinationinfo/export' |
|
|
}, |
|
|
}, |
|
|
dataForm: { |
|
|
dataForm: { |
|
|
id: '', |
|
|
id: '', |
|
|